Relatively little attention has been paid to sex differences in the migration of birds in autumn. We studied the autumn migration strategy of molecularly sexed males and females in the globally threatened aquatic warbler Acrocephalus paludicola. We captured 176 birds at a stopover site in the Loire estuary at Donges, France. The median date for the passage of adults was 8 days earlier in males than females, although the timing of migration in first-year males and females was similar. This indicates that males, who are without parental duties, can start their migration earlier than females and first-year birds. Adults were significantly heavier than immature birds but did not have higher fat scores. In both age categories, more males (two to three times more) were captured. However, various factors (including tape-luring) can affect observed sex ratio. 相似文献

Scent-marking is a frequent behaviour of highly social ground squirrels and might play an important role in their social dynamics.
Female Columbian ground squirrels exhibit considerable scent-marking during the reproductive period. We examined how gestating
and lactating females responded to jugal gland scent-marks of same-sexed and opposite-sexed conspecifics with attention to
genetic relatedness and the geographical location of the territory of individuals. We tested the dear-enemy, threat-level
and kin-discrimination hypotheses to explain patterns of scent-marking. Females sniffed the scent of non-neighbouring males
significantly longer than other types of scent categories and tended to over mark the scent of females more than the scent
of males. Furthermore, females sniffed significantly longer at scents during gestation than during lactation. We concluded
that scent-marking mainly functioned in the defence of female territories and for protection of pups against infanticidal
females (threat-level hypothesis). Our results were also in accordance with the kin-discrimination hypothesis, because greater
attention was paid to the marks of non-kin females. Kin females might not pose an infanticidal threat, perhaps explaining
greater tolerance among related reproductive females. We concluded that scent-marking may be a relatively low-cost means of
territorial defence, as well as a means of communication of aspects of individual identity. 相似文献

Congenital adrenal hyperplasia (CAH) is an autosomal recessive disorder with an incidence of 1/15 000. More than 90% of CAH cases result from mutations of CYP21, leading to 21-hydroxylase deficiency. In its classical form, CAH is severe and consists of the virilizing (increase of androgens) and salt-wasting (lack of aldosterone) phenotype. When a proband exists, early prenatal diagnosis for CAH can be performed by direct molecular analysis in the first trimester. We describe herein two cases suggesting that the prenatal diagnosis of CAH can be initiated by the sonographic appearance of the adrenal gland at the second-trimester scan in the absence of a family history. In an attempt to better understand the mechanism underlying lateral collision avoidance in flying insects, we trained honeybees
(Apis mellifera) to fly through a large (95-cm wide) flight tunnel. We found that, depending on the entrance and feeder positions, honeybees
would either center along the corridor midline or fly along one wall. Bees kept following one wall even when a major (150-cm
long) part of the opposite wall was removed. These findings cannot be accounted for by the “optic flow balance” hypothesis
that has been put forward to explain the typical bees’ “centering response” observed in narrower corridors. Both centering
and wall-following behaviors are well accounted for, however, by a control scheme called the lateral optic flow regulator, i.e., a feedback system that strives to maintain the unilateral optic flow constant. The power of this control scheme is
that it would allow the bee to guide itself visually in a corridor without having to measure its speed or distance from the
walls. 相似文献

Changes in agricultural land use are responsible for significant modifications in mountain landscapes. This study is part
of an interdisciplinary research on the processes and consequences of spontaneous afforestation of Pyrenean landscapes by
ash, and the possibilities for its management. We address the relationships between vegetation dynamics and land-use change
from the combination of an agricultural study of change in farm management and an ecological study of grassland colonization
by ash. In the framework of a village case study, we characterized parcels management and land-use histories, and analyzed
the dynamics of the composition of grassland vegetation communities. From a joint analysis of the results obtained in each
discipline, we discuss the limitations and complementarities of the two approaches for the interdisciplinary assessment of
the afforestation process. 相似文献

We have used a Y-chromosome specific DNA probe in a controlled study to determine the presence of Y-chromosome material and to detect numerical abnormalities in uncultured amniotic fluid cells by fluorescent hybridization. Using this non-radioactive method, we correctly predicted fetal sex within 48 h in all but 3 of 54 cases and identified an XYY syndrome. The technique was previously tested with no false-positive or false-negative results on cultured interphase or metaphase nuclei of fetal fibroblasts and adult T-lymphocytes. Fluorescent in situ hybridization was applied to long-term fixed cytogenetic preparations up to 44 months old and was shown to be reliable. 相似文献

We investigated removal of noroviruses, sapoviruses, and rotaviruses in a full-scale membrane bioreactor (MBR) plant by monitoring virus concentrations in wastewater samples during two gastroenteritis seasons and evaluating the adsorption of viruses to mixed liquor suspended solids (MLSS). Sapoviruses and rotaviruses were detected in 25% of MBR effluent samples with log reduction values of 3- and 2-logs in geometric mean concentrations, respectively, while noroviruses were detected in only 6% of the samples. We found that norovirus and sapovirus concentrations in the solid phase of mixed liquor samples were significantly higher than in the liquid phase (P < 0.01, t test), while the concentration of rotaviruses was similar in both phases. The efficiency of adsorption of the rotavirus G1P[8] strain to MLSS was significantly less than norovirus GI.1 and GII.4 and sapovirus GI.2 strains (P < 0.01, t test). Differences in the adsorption of viruses to MLSS may cause virus type-specific removal during the MBR treatment process as shown by this study. 相似文献

Small Auchenorrhyncha use substrate-borne vibrations to communicate. Although this behaviour is well known in adult leafhoppers, so far no studies have been published on nymphs. Here we checked the occurrence of vibrational communication in Scaphoideus titanus (Hemiptera: Cicadellidae) nymphs as a possible explanation of their aggregative distributions on host plants. We studied possible vibratory emissions of isolated and grouped nymphs, as well as their behavioural responses to vibration stimuli that simulated presence of conspecifics, to disturbance noise, white noise and predator spiders. None of our synthetic stimuli or pre-recorded substrate vibrations from nymphs elicited specific vibration responses and only those due to grooming or mechanical contacts of the insect with the leaf were recorded. Thus, S. titanus nymphs showed to not use species-specific vibrations neither for intra- nor interspecific communication and also did not produce alarm vibrations when facing potential predators. We conclude that their aggregative behaviour is independent from a vibrational communication. 相似文献

In studying the ant genus Azteca, a Neotropical group of arboreal species, we aimed to determine the extent to which the ants use predation and/or aggressiveness to protect their host plants from defoliating insects. We compared a territorially dominant, carton-nester, Azteca chartifex, and three plant-ant species. Azteca alfari and Azteca ovaticeps are associated with the myrmecophyte Cecropia (Cecropiaceae) and their colonies shelter in its hollow branches; whereas Azteca bequaerti is associated with Tococa guianensis (Melastomataceae) and its colonies shelter in leaf pouches situated at the base of the laminas. Whereas A. bequaerti workers react to the vibrations transmitted by the lamina when an alien insect lands on a leaf making it unnecessary for them to patrol their plant, the workers of the three other species rather discover prey by contact. The workers of all four species use a predatory behaviour involving spread-eagling alien insects after recruiting nestmates at short range, and, in some cases, at long range. Because A. alfari and A. ovaticeps discard part of the insects they kill, we deduced that the workers' predatory behaviour and territorial aggressiveness combine in the biotic defence of their host tree. 相似文献

Many anadromous fish species, when migrating from the sea to spawn in fresh waters, can potentially be a valuable prey for
larger predatory fish, thereby efficiently linking these two ecosystems. Here, we assess the contribution of anadromous fish
to the diet of European catfish (Silurus glanis) in a large river system (Garonne, southwestern France) using stable isotope analysis and allis shad (Alosa alosa) as an example of anadromous fish. Allis shad caught in the Garonne had a very distinct marine δ13C value, over 8‰ higher after lipid extraction compared to the mean δ13C value of all other potential freshwater prey fish. The δ13C values of European catfish varied considerably between these two extremes and some individuals were clearly specializing
on freshwater prey, whereas others specialized on anadromous fish. The mean contribution of anadromous fish to the entire
European catfish population was estimated to be between 53% and 65%, depending on the fractionation factor used for δ13C. 相似文献
